Live Speaking Practice


When you take a Live Speaking Lesson, we will use your computer’s microphone throughout the lesson to speak to your tutor. You also have the option of using your camera to share your video with your tutor. TriLingo records these audio and video lessons and retains them until you close your TriLingo account. TriLingo uses this data to help improve the quality of the lessons and for internal research purposes.


TriLingo does not share any of your personal data with your tutor. You are completely anonymous to them by default, and you can freely choose whether you show them your video or tell them any personal details, such as your name, during the conversation. TriLingo only shares some basic skill level information with the tutor prior to your lesson, so they understand how best to speak to you.


Speaking Challenges


Some lessons involve you speaking into the app. To recognise speech, your audio may be sent to a third-party provider such as Google, Apple, or Amazon Web Services. We may ask you to allow TriLingo to collect and analyse your speech data to help us understand the effectiveness of our lessons and to improve the product. If you choose not to share your audio with us, or if we haven’t asked you yet, then your audio will not be used in this way. Any audio you agree to send to TriLingo is anonymised when it reaches our servers to ensure that no trace of your personal data remains attached to the audio.
